Description
1,4-Diazabicyclo[5.2.0]Nonane(9Ci) is a specialized bicyclic diamine compound with a unique bridged structure, serving as a valuable intermediate in advanced organic synthesis. Its rigid molecular framework makes it a crucial building block for constructing complex nitrogen-containing heterocycles and ligands. This high-purity chemical is essential for researchers and manufacturers in the pharmaceutical and agrochemical sectors, where it is used to develop novel active ingredients and fine chemicals.

Basic Information
| Product Name | 1,4-Diazabicyclo[5.2.0]Nonane(9Ci) |
| CAS No. | 255833-47-7 |
| Molecular Formula | C7H12N2 |
| Molecular Weight | 124.18 g/mol |
| Synonyms | 1,4-Diazabicyclo[5.2.0]nonane; 1,4-Diazabicyclo[5.2.0]nonane (9CI); 2,5-Diazabicyclo[4.3.0]nonane (related isomer); Bicyclo[5.2.0]nonane, 1,4-diaza-; 1,4-Diazabicyclo[5.2.0]nonane, 9CI; 255833-47-7 (CAS); DBNO (abbreviation). |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Keep away from heat, sparks, and open flame. Due to its nitrogen-containing structure, it should be stored separately from strong oxidizing agents.
